Output d178c4fcafc36cc8a4d98ba998dc151f2a5a702356def0127afc322e2bd2007a:1

value
3696704828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9be183d6c2b60d878d13fff6ac9aa411784db8c0 OP_EQUAL
address
3FuEpLL4esXczzyGcENjwghzhLpkLkgzFV
transaction
d178c4fcafc36cc8a4d98ba998dc151f2a5a702356def0127afc322e2bd2007a
confirmations
172126
spent
true